Web25. máj 2024 · The Connection Between Talc and Asbestos Talc is a naturally occurring mineral known for its moisture absorbing properties. Talc is found in close proximity to asbestos when growing in its natural state. Exposure to asbestos is the only well-established cause of mesothelioma in the United States. Web21. dec 2024 · Naturally occurring talc is mined and pulverized before being subjected to flotation processes to remove various impurities such as asbestos (tremolite); carbon; dolomite; iron oxide; and various other magnesium and carbonate minerals.
